Bug Description
The kserve webapp does not appear in the kubeflow UI. Per Kserve docs, the web app has been included as a part of the kubeflow/manifests since Kubeflow 1.5 release.
See kserve docs.
To Reproduce
Deploy kubeflow, the models navigation is missing from the sidebar in the UI.
